Residential Pressure Washing in Fayetteville, NC
This home in Fayetteville, NC is in a beautifully planted yard. The exterior of the home need a residential pressure washing services to remove the organic growth and plant pollen and other fallout. Our first step was a walk through to check for any windows or doors that may be open to ensure no water enters the home. Next, property protection is applied to the electrical outlets, lights, cameras. And any other sensitive areas. The home is then rinsed to cool the surface in preparation for the surfactant application. The entire home is treated with a solution from bottom to top to prevent streaking. After allowing the solution to dwell the home is rinsed top to bottom. When the house wash is complete all of the property protection is removed. This home looks great again and is ready for the summer.
